Impact of Government Regulations
Government regulations continue to have a significant influence on the Dubai rental market. The Dubai government has introduced various tenant laws aimed at creating a more transparent, stable, and tenant-friendly environment.
Key regulations include:
- Rent Increase Calculator. Limits how much landlords can increase rent, ensuring price stability for tenants.
- Tenant Protection Laws. Protect tenants from unfair eviction practices and secure their rights under tenancy agreements.
- Minimum Rental Contract Duration. New laws ensure longer-term rental stability for tenants, allowing them to enjoy their homes for extended periods without concern over abrupt changes.
Popular Areas for Renters in 2025
As the Dubai rental market evolves, certain areas continue to emerge as prime locations for renters, offering a variety of amenities, accessibility, and lifestyle options. Some of the most popular areas for renters in 2025 include:
- Dubai Marina — a popular choice for expatriates and professionals due to its proximity to business centers, public transport, and leisure activities.
- Downtown Dubai — known for its iconic landmarks such as the Burj Khalifa, this area is in high demand for both long-term and short-term rentals in Dubai.
- Jumeirah Village Circle (JVC) — a growing residential area that offers more affordable options while still being close to central Dubai.
- Dubai Hills Estate — a family-friendly neighborhood offering modern amenities, parks, and schools, making it attractive for families.
- Dubai South and Al Furjan — newer, sustainable developments gaining popularity for their eco-friendly features and affordable pricing.
These areas are becoming increasingly popular for renters seeking a balance between affordability, convenience, and quality of life.
The Role of Technology in the Rental Market
Technology continues to play an essential role in transforming Dubai’s rental market. The integration of property technology in Dubai has streamlined the renting process for both landlords and tenants, making it easier to search, negotiate, and sign contracts online. Key technological advancements include:
- Virtual Tours. Potential tenants can now view properties remotely, saving time and enhancing the renting experience.
- Online Payment Systems. Rent payments can be made securely online, eliminating the need for manual transactions.
- Smart Home Features. Increasing demand for smart home rentals, where properties come equipped with energy-efficient and automated systems.
- Artificial Intelligence. AI and data analytics are helping landlords optimize rental pricing and predict market trends.
In 2025, smart home rentals are becoming more prevalent, offering renters the latest in home automation technology. From smart thermostats and lighting systems to advanced security features, these properties are in high demand as renters seek more convenient, energy-efficient, and tech-savvy living spaces.
